Streetfilms: PARK(ing) Day 2007 NYC (en español)

The geniuses at Streetfilms have begun taking some of their films and translating them to Spanish.  As we rapidly approach Parking Day both here and in New York, it makes sense that the fist film to be translated is their film on last year's Parking Day NYC.  For more information on Parking Day LA, click here.  For more information on Streetfilms en español, read on:

Park(ing) Day fue un gran éxito en la ciudad de Nueva York el añopasado. Se convirtieron muchos espacios de estacionamiento en espaciosverdes para la gente. Se acerca Park(ing)Day 2008, viernes, el 19 deseptiembre ocuparemos 50 espacios en los 5 condados de la ciudad.
